Founded in 1909, Keene State College is a non-profit public higher education institution located in the rural setting of the medium-sized town of Keene (population range of 10,000-49,999 inhabitants), New Hampshire. Officially accredited and/or recognized by the Commission on Institutions of Higher Education of the New England Association of Schools and Colleges, Keene State College (KSC) is a small (uniRank enrollment range: 5,000-5,999 students) coeducational higher education institution. Keene State College (KSC) offers courses and programs leading to officially recognized higher education degrees such as pre-bachelor degrees (i.e. certificates, diplomas, associate or foundation degrees), bachelor degrees, master degrees in several areas of study. This 109 years old higher-education institution has a selective admission policy based on entrance examinations and students' past academic record and grades. The admission rate range is 70-80% making this US higher education organization a somewhat selective institution. International students are welcome to apply for enrollment.
